    Title: While sitting in tashddud some scholers say we have to lift index finger continiously and some say's only when we reach ASHHADU LAILAHAILLALAH , what is correct and which is supporting hadit for these two views?

    (Fatwa: 831/831=M/1430)

     

    The second way is preferable i.e. raise the fingers at la ilaha and put it down on illallah, it is supported by Hadith and traditions:

    وفي المحيط أنها سنة يرفعها عند النفي ويضعها عند الإثبات وهو قول أبي حنيفة ومحمد وكثرت به الآثار والأخبار فالعمل به أولى ا ه فهو صريح في أن المفتى به هو الإشارة بالمسبحة مع عقد الأصابع على الكيفية المذكورة لا مع بسطها (شامي 2:217)
